Understanding the Remote Work Landscape
The shift towards remote work has been accelerated by advancements in technology and changes in employee expectations. Here are some key trends shaping the remote work landscape:
- Flexibility: Workers now prioritize flexibility in their jobs, leading companies to offer remote options.
- Global Talent Pool: Organizations are no longer limited by geography, allowing them to hire talent from around the world.
- Digital Communication Tools: Tools like Zoom, Slack, and Trello have become indispensable for collaboration.

To thrive in a remote work environment, certain skills will be essential. Here’s a detailed breakdown of the most in-demand skills for remote jobs in the coming years:
1. Technical Proficiency
As remote jobs often rely on digital tools, having a solid grasp of technology is critical. Key technical skills include:
- Proficiency in programming languages such as Java, Python, or JavaScript.
- Familiarity with cloud computing platforms like AWS, Google Cloud, or Azure.
- Understanding of cybersecurity principles to protect company data.
2. Communication Skills
Effective communication is vital for remote collaboration. Professionals need to be adept in:
- Written communication: Crafting clear and concise emails, reports, and documentation.
- Verbal communication: Engaging effectively in virtual meetings and presentations.
- Active listening: Understanding and responding appropriately to colleagues.
3. Time Management
Remote work often requires individuals to manage their own schedules. Essential time management skills include:
- Setting clear priorities: Identifying tasks that yield the best results.
- Using productivity tools: Implementing tools such as Asana, Todoist, or Notion to stay organized.
- Establishing routines: Creating a daily schedule that promotes productivity.
4. Problem-Solving Abilities
The ability to tackle challenges independently is crucial in remote roles. This includes:
- Analytical thinking: Breaking down complex problems and identifying solutions.
- Creativity: Developing innovative approaches to overcome obstacles.
- Decision-making: Making informed choices to drive projects forward.
Emerging Technologies and Their Impact
As technology evolves, certain emerging fields are expected to create new remote job opportunities. Understanding these areas can give job seekers an edge:
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ning
AI and machine learning are revolutionizing industries. Skills in these domains will include:
- Data analysis and interpretation.
- Developing machine learning algorithms.
- Working with AI-driven tools for automation.
Blockchain Technology
Blockchain is expanding beyond cryptocurrencies, leading to a demand for skills in:
- Smart contract development.
- Blockchain architecture and design.
- Understanding regulatory implications.
Data Analytics
Businesses increasingly rely on data for decision-making. Key skills in data analytics include:
- Data visualization tools such as Tableau or Power BI.
- Statistical analysis and predictive modeling.
- Data mining and extraction techniques.
Building Your Skillset
Gaining the necessary skills for remote jobs requires a proactive approach. Here are effective strategies to build your skillset:
1. Online Courses
Many platforms offer affordable or free courses to enhance your skills:
- Coursera: University-level courses on a wide range of topics.
- edX: Courses from top universities and institutions.
- Udacity: Nanodegree programs focused on tech skills.
2. Networking
Connecting with professionals in your field can open doors to learning and job opportunities:
- Join industry-specific forums and online communities.
- Attend virtual conferences and webinars.
- Participate in LinkedIn groups related to your professional interests.
3. Hands-On Experience
Apply your skills in real-world scenarios:
- Freelancing or consulting to gain practical experience.
- Working on personal projects or contributing to open-source initiatives.
- Engaging in internships, even if they are remote.
